COM Ports above 9 are not supported — at Version 4

Reported by: Joerg Mahmens Owned by:
Component: uart Version: VirtualBox 3.1.4
Keywords: Cc:
Guest type: other Host type: Windows

Description (last modified by Frank Mehnert)

Using a Virtual COM Port on Windows XP Host by COM2USB Adapter which creates a COM10 Port. This COM10 is not usable as Hostport. Using an other USB Port which creates a COM9 is usable.

The following Message is created:
Failed to open host device 'COM10'
(VERR_FILE_NOT_FOUND).

comment:3 by Garbz, 11 years ago

This is not a bug and can be closed. Windows provides legacy names only for COM ports 1 through to 9.

For all other COM ports you must use the full device naming convention under windows. i.e.:

\\.\COM10
